Beef Veggie Soft Bites

👶 12-18 months

Beef Veggie Soft Bites are a nutritious and easy-to-eat snack perfect for babies aged 12-18 months. Packed with protein from the beef and essential vitamins from the vegetables, they promote healthy growth and development. These soft bites are ideal for little ones learning to self-feed, as they are tender and easy to chew.

🥕 Ingredients

  • 1 cup ground beef
  • 1/2 cup finely chopped spinach
  • 1/2 cup grated carrots
  • 1/4 cup mashed sweet potato
  • 1/4 cup breadcrumbs
  • 1 egg
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on onion powder

👨‍🍳 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. In a skillet, heat olive oil and cook ground beef until browned.
  3. Add spinach, carrots, sweet potato, garlic powder, and onion powder to the skillet and mix well.
  4. Remove from heat and let cool slightly, then stir in breadcrumbs and egg.
  5. Form mixture into small bite-sized balls and place on a baking sheet.
  6. Bake for 20 minutes or until cooked through and golden brown.

🍴 Serving Suggestion

Serve these soft bites warm or at room temperature. Pair with a side of yogurt or a dip like hummus for added flavor.

💡 Tips & Tricks

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. You can also freeze these bites for up to 2 months. Adjust texture by mashing or pureeing for younger babies.
